Output 18e3c531307bdc7c2f72fbfaba6bbe66277364e1ae26af127e34427dde704354:7

value
6100007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29f4dc124840c5c640fb9e93fe871d6199eac042 OP_EQUAL
address
35WrxZC2cVxj2AJsBqxuCojkRm3U34z4Pv
transaction
18e3c531307bdc7c2f72fbfaba6bbe66277364e1ae26af127e34427dde704354
spent
true